Amy Rheannon Turner (born 31 July 1984) is an English rugby union player.

Playing career
She represented England at the 2010 Women's Rugby World Cup.[1] She started playing rugby at the age of 5.[2] She returned from injury for England's match against Ireland in their 2010 Women's Six Nations Championship match.[3]
